The Anti-Aging Conversation
In a society obsessed with the idea of “anti-aging,” the actress stands firm in her conviction to strike the phrase from our vocabulary. At the Radically Reframing Aging Summit, Curtis shared,

“ This word ‘anti-aging’ has to be struck. I am pro-aging. I want to age with intelligence, grace, dignity, verve, and energy.”

Curtis does not want her aging to be something she’s ashamed off, instead she wants to embrace every moment of it. “I don’t want to hide from it,” she emphasized.

During an interview with Forbes, the actress reflected on the ages that her parents died. Her mother passed at 79, and her father at 85. Therefore, Curtis is aware of the reality that comes with aging, but she is determined to enjoy her life and focus on the important part of it, which is the love she shares with her family.

Additionally, getting older has been far from hindering. Curtis said the year before entering her mid-sixties was the most creative she had ever been in her life.Her words echo in the hearts of many who have long been searching for a spokesperson who could articulate the beauty of aging without the desire to reverse it. Curtis’ perspective is shared by other celebrities at the summit, aligning with the event’s goal to celebrate aging as one of life’s greatest gifts.
